Pusha T steps down from GOOD Music

 


After seven years at the helm of Kanye West's label, Pusha T has stepped down as president of GOOD Music.


Pusha T discussed Kanye West's situation and his relationship with him during his tenure. Pusha has stated that he will be separating himself from Yeezy now that things have deteriorated with him.

One of the most disappointing moments was when Kanye West said he didn't think Hitler was all that bad "It's more than that, and there's nothing to tap dance around. It's incorrect. Period. But, to me, it's just me and him having another disagreement. Because we've had it for years."

He expanded "He's not talking to me right now. If you're not with it, you're not down. And I'm not on board. I'm not going to change my mind. I'm not on board. This new stuff has been brought to my attention. I'm not sure. It's something that just kind of tells me he's not feeling well. That is something I will say. It's going to places where there's no way to avoid it."

Pusha T discussed his Make America Great Again t-shirt, which he wore during Trump's campaign. "Remember, I'm the one who said the MAGA hat is the new Klu Klux Klan hood while he's working on my album," Push added. "He's feuding with Obama. I met Barack Obama. But it's the same with him and the Drake situation. I'm dealing with this and that, and he's doing shows [with Drake]."


Kanye and Pusha T spoke and agreed to disagree. "I just expressed myself," Kanye said. "I express myself a lot to him," Pusha stated. "He shared his thoughts with me. 'Thank you,' he said as he hung up the phone. I know you disagree with me, but you never murder me in public. And some people are eager to get started.
